Yang Huai, who came to deliver the news of death, was dressed in white mourning clothes, his eyes bloodshot, his face deathly pale, almost without any color.

General Yang had only one daughter under his knee, no son. Among the nephews and younger generation, General Yang liked Yang Huai the most. Yang Huai’s martial arts were all personally taught by General Yang.

General Yang died miserably on the battlefield, not even leaving a complete corpse. Such a tragic end left the entire Guangning Army grieving uncontrollably. Yang Huai was especially heartbroken.

Pei Qinghe felt a heavy weight in her heart and comforted him in a low voice: “Although General Yang died in battle, he dealt a heavy blow to the rebel army. Tao Wudi also took a knife wound and was seriously injured.”

“The rebel army may withdraw troops soon.”

Tao Wudi was slashed by General Yang before his death, and his injury was not light. The rebel army relied entirely on Tao Wudi’s cruel and bloody methods to suppress them. Once Tao Wudi fell, morale would quickly disperse.

Although these words were heavy and harsh, from the overall perspective, the Guangning Army had made a great contribution, and General Yang died a worthy death.

Yang Huai wiped his eyes heavily with his sleeve and said in a low voice: “General, rest assured, the Guangning Army will not sink like this. One thousand men escaped back from the battlefield, plus the soldiers left behind. The Guangning Army now still has five thousand men. Great Uncle Father is dead, but there are still a crowd of Yang Family members. Morale has not dispersed, and the Guangning Army’s military banner has not fallen.”

“Before Great Uncle Father passed, he instructed that if he died in battle, I do not need to observe mourning and should quickly marry into the Pei family as a son-in-law. Please approve, General!”

Pei Yan was startled, her eyebrows shooting up.

Pei Qinghe glanced over, and Pei Yan had to swallow the words that were on the tip of her tongue.

“Marriage is not urgent.” Pei Qinghe said warmly: “General Yang wrote me a letter, and I understand his intention. Since the Pei Family Army has allied with the Guangning Army, if the Guangning Army encounters danger, the Pei Family Army will never stand by.”

“You focus on observing mourning for General Yang. The matter of marriage can be discussed again in a year.”

For a consanguineous nephew, observing mourning for one year for his uncle is sufficient.

Yang Huai, immersed in grief, indeed had no intention for marriage. He only came because of Great Uncle Father’s instruction. With Pei Qinghe saying this, the giant stone in Yang Huai’s chest loosened, and he cupped his hands in a deep bow: “Thank you, General.”

Pei Yan also let out a long sigh of relief.

That’s right, what’s the rush for marriage? Wait another year!

Pei Qinghe gave Pei Yan a look. Pei Yan unusually softened once and said to Yang Huai: “You rarely come here, stay a few days before going back!”

Yang Huai sighed: “No need, I must go back immediately. Cousin Brother Yang Hu is still too young, and I’m afraid he can’t hold down the entire army alone.”

In terms of bloodline, both Yang Huai and Yang Hu are General Yang’s consanguineous nephews, and they have been in the barracks for ten years with the highest official positions. Now that General Yang is dead, someone needs to take over to command the Guangning Army.

Yang Huai will marry into the Pei family as a son-in-law in the future, so he is not suitable to be the commander. For the commander position, Yang Hu is the most appropriate choice.

However, there are two veteran military generals in the army who are not convinced by Yang Hu.

Pei Qinghe understood in her heart and said to Yang Huai: “In that case, go back early. Pei Yan, go to the Guangning Army on my behalf and stay in the barracks for a month.”

With Pei Qinghe expressing her attitude in support of the Yang brothers Yang Huai and Yang Hu, the panicked morale of the Guangning Army could stabilize more quickly.

Pei Yan knew the importance and cupped her hands to accept the order.

Pei Qinghe then called Shi Yan and asked how much grain was stored in Pei Family Village.

Shi Yan immediately understood and worked the abacus to tally the accounts, squeezing out one thousand shi of military rations.

Pei Yan brought one thousand shi of military rations and grandly escorted Yang Huai back to the Guangning Army. Yang Hu was overjoyed and personally welcomed her with a crowd of generals.

Pei Yan, as the number four figure in the Pei Family Army and Yang Huai’s fiancée, came at this time with a large amount of military rations to support Yang Hu. The unfavorable voices saying Yang Hu was too young to be commander soon weakened.

Yang Huai was full of gratitude and privately said to Pei Yan: “Thank you for coming this time.”

Pei Yan spoke bluntly: “Why thank me? Cousin Sister Qinghe told me to come, that’s why I came. If you want to thank someone, thank her.”

Still that straightforward manner, with dark skin, tall and sturdy, fierce-looking, speaking without mincing words, straight to the heart.

Yang Huai was both amused and exasperated, a thread of tenderness quietly surging in his heart. He reached out and held Pei Yan’s hand, which was not soft at all: “General Pei is giving aid to us Yang brothers on your account. Of course I must thank you.”

Pei Yan was utterly clueless about romance, pulled her hand back, and glared warningly: “Not married yet, no touching.”

Yang Huai: “…”

In adversity, a person’s growth speed is astonishing.

During this period, Yang Hu quickly became steady. Pei Zhi came with Pei Yan to the Guangning Barracks, and Yang Hu actually restrained his previous pervert behavior, no longer pestering her, and kept a distant distance.

Pei Zhi breathed a sigh of relief but was also a bit curious, muttering a few words to Pei Yan privately.

Pei Yan grinned: “What’s there not to understand? Before, when General Yang was still alive, Yang Hu never thought about the distant future. Now that General Yang died in battle and Yang Hu became commander, it’s impossible for him to abandon the Guangning Army and marry into the Pei family as a son-in-law. Since there’s no possibility of being husband and wife, naturally he shouldn’t pester anymore.”

Pei Zhi exclaimed in amazement: “You usually seem so rough like a tiger, turns out you’re not a blockhead.”

Pei Yan laughed and spat: “You’re the blockhead. Before, you couldn’t stand Yang Hu and beat him until his face was black and blue. Now that he keeps his distance, you’re not happy again.”

Among the Pei Clan girls, there were no lack of outstanding beauties. Pei Qinghe was clear and heroic, Pei Yun had a beautiful appearance, Pei Xuan was sweet and soft. Pei Zhi had almond eyes and peach cheeks, charming and lively, especially eye-catching. There were quite a few men in the Pei Family Army who admired Pei Zhi.

Pei Zhi was used to being pampered by everyone, and suddenly being distanced by Yang Hu made her feel uncomfortable.

Pei Zhi, having her thoughts exposed, was a bit annoyed and embarrassed, glaring at Pei Yan. Pei Yan dragged her to the training ground for a “sparring” session.

Pei Yan had immense strength, her fists and feet fierce and ruthless. Pei Zhi struggled on both sides and soon fell into a disadvantage.

Yang Hu watched from afar and sent someone to call Yang Huai to come save the day.

After Yang Huai arrived, he said irritably: “If you want to play the hero saving the beauty, go yourself. Why call me?”

Yang Hu’s gaze darkened: “Pei Zhi is a good miss, but I can’t be a son-in-law, so I shouldn’t pester her anymore.”

Without waiting for Yang Huai to speak, Yang Hu turned and left.

His back figure was somewhat lonely, quite pitiful.

Yang Huai couldn’t help sighing, then turned his head to look. In the field, Pei Zhi was beaten staggering back, Pei Yan like a tiger, not holding back at all!

Yang Huai braced himself and told the two to stop.

Pei Yan had been repeatedly instructed by Pei Qinghe and finally remembered to save some face for her fiancé in public, quickly stopping: “Your future brother-in-law Zhang Kou has spoken, so it ends here today.”

Pei Zhi awkwardly wiped the sweat beads from her forehead and teased: “Thank you, brother-in-law.”

Pei Yan was thick-skinned and didn’t care, but Yang Huai blushed furiously.

In the late Jing Dynasty, natural disasters struck frequently, wars raged without end, corvée labor was heavy, and the people couldn't live. Pei Qinghe led hundreds of clanspeople to survive in the Chaotic Times. She only wanted to live well, yet she accidentally stepped onto the path of contending for supremacy over the land, a road of no return. No one supports my ambition to reach the blue clouds; I tread through snow to the mountain peak myself.
